repo.or.cz
/
mono-project.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[interp] Include lmf wrapper in aot image
2018-04-26
Vlad Br
e
zae
[
i
nterp]
I
ncl
u
de lmf w
r
apper
in
a
ot
image
commit
|
commitdiff
|
tree
2018-04-26
V
l
a
d Brezae
[interp] Interp ent
r
y trampoline fo
r
arm64
commit
|
commitdiff
|
tree
2018-04-25
V
l
ad Breza
e
[interp] Enter in t
h
e inter
p
th
r
o
ugh a si
n
gl
e
g
eneric
.
.
.
commit
|
commitdiff
|
tree
2018-04-13
Vlad Brez
a
e
[interp
]
Ex
i
t from finally ab
o
rt p
r
otected block wh
e
n
.
.
.
commit
|
commitdiff
|
tree
2018-04-12
Vl
a
d Brez
a
e
[in
t
er
p
] Fix res
u
mi
n
g from finally block (#8195
)
commit
|
commitdiff
|
tree
2018-04-11
Vlad Brezae
[profiler] Fix heapshot frequency calculatio
n
(#8163)
commit
|
commitdiff
|
tree
2018-03-21
Vlad
Brezae
[sgen] Fix
s
c
a
nning of large arra
y
s
(#7672)
commit
|
commitdiff
|
tree
2018-03-20
Vlad Brezae
[
sgen] Finish th
r
ead
p
ool work before shutting down
.
.
.
commit
|
commitdiff
|
tree
2018-03-16
Vlad Brezae
[tests] Pr
e
ven
t
starvation by thread doing GCs (#
7
65
1
)
commit
|
commitdiff
|
tree
2018-03-15
V
lad Brezae
[sgen]
U
se
current nursery size when computing
a
l
l
o
wance
.
.
.
commit
|
commitdiff
|
tree
2018-03-15
Vlad
Brezae
[inter
p
] Don't crash when free
i
ng delegate
f
tn
p
tr
.
.
.
commit
|
commitdiff
|
tree
2018-03-09
Vlad Brezae
[int
e
r
p
] Fi
x
return of value type fr
o
m interp to native
.
.
.
commit
|
commitdiff
|
tree
2018-03-09
V
la
d
Brez
a
e
[interp] Fix sta
c
k u
s
age after t
h
row (#
7
461)
commit
|
commitdiff
|
tree
2018-03-08
Vlad
B
rezae
[interp] Fix pi
n
voke from d
y
namic me
t
h
o
d
s
commit
|
commitdiff
|
tree
2018-03-08
Vlad
Brez
a
e
[
interp] F
i
x
detection of
p
invoke call
commit
|
commitdiff
|
tree
2018-03-08
Vlad Brezae
[interp] Fi
x
runti
m
e i
n
voke of pinvoke metho
d
commit
|
commitdiff
|
tree
2018-03-08
Vla
d
Brezae
[interp]
Let the backe
n
d de
a
l
w
ith thiscall
c
co
n
v
commit
|
commitdiff
|
tree
2018-03-08
V
l
ad Brezae
[interp] Fix E
H
with
exception thrown from icall
commit
|
commitdiff
|
tree
2018-02-26
Vlad
B
rezae
[
t
hreads] R
e
duce race wi
n
dow with async abort (#7274)
commit
|
commitdiff
|
tree
2018-02-23
Vlad Brezae
[sge
n
] Check if we a
r
e exceeding
t
h
e
worke
r
c
ount
l
imit
.
.
.
commit
|
commitdiff
|
tree
2018-02-23
Vlad Br
e
z
a
e
[t
e
s
t
s] Avoid
f
al
s
e pinni
n
g
i
n weak-fields t
e
st
commit
|
commitdiff
|
tree
2018-02-23
Vlad Breza
e
[
tests] Avoid
false pinning
i
n tests
commit
|
commitdiff
|
tree
2018-02-21
V
lad
B
rezae
[
i
nterp]
U
se frame_a
d
dr as base
po
i
nter in more places
.
.
.
commit
|
commitdiff
|
tree
2018-02-15
Vlad Brezae
[interp] Add
m
is
s
ing
ex
c
eption checkp
o
i
n
ts (#691
7
)
commit
|
commitdiff
|
tree
2018-02-14
Vlad Brezae
[
interp] Fix
n
at
i
ve to
interp transi
t
i
o
n (#
6
8
68)
commit
|
commitdiff
|
tree
2018-02-13
Vlad
B
rezae
[interp] Fix CEE_UNBOX
commit
|
commitdiff
|
tree
2018-02-10
Vlad Brezae
[int
e
rp] Add class failure c
h
e
cks
commit
|
commitdiff
|
tree
2018-02-10
Vlad
B
rezae
[inte
r
p] Fix varargs passing
commit
|
commitdiff
|
tree
2018-02-10
V
l
ad B
r
ezae
[inter
p
] A
l
ig
n
vt stack in some places
commit
|
commitdiff
|
tree
2018-02-10
Vlad Brezae
[inte
r
p]
Add
de
f
ine
f
or val
u
e type alignment
commit
|
commitdiff
|
tree
2018-02-06
V
l
ad Brezae
[inte
r
p] Add support
for varar
g
c
a
ll convent
i
on
commit
|
commitdiff
|
tree
2018-02-06
Vlad Brezae
[glib] Include ALIGN_TO an
d
ALIGN_PTR_
T
O
commit
|
commitdiff
|
tree
2018-02-06
Vlad
B
r
ezae
[
i
nterp
]
Add sto
r
ag
e
fetching for typedbyref
commit
|
commitdiff
|
tree
2018-02-06
Vlad B
r
ezae
[interp] Ad
d
class check f
o
r
refanyval
commit
|
commitdiff
|
tree
2018-02-06
Vla
d
B
r
ezae
[in
t
erp] Remove virtual
call dupl
i
cated
c
o
de
commit
|
commitdiff
|
tree
2018-02-06
Vlad Brezae
[
interp]
R
em
o
ve v
o
id ca
l
l
dup
l
icat
e
d code
commit
|
commitdiff
|
tree
2018-02-06
Vlad B
r
ezae
[i
n
ter
p
] Rename variable
commit
|
commitdiff
|
tree
2018-02-06
Vlad Bre
z
ae
[in
t
erp] Remove
s
ome null checks
commit
|
commitdiff
|
tree
2018-01-31
Vlad
Brez
a
e
Revert "
[
mini] Align
s
tack when resuming
t
o catch handler"
commit
|
commitdiff
|
tree
2018-01-26
Vla
d
Brezae
[inte
r
p] Don
'
t push lmf with no int
e
r
p
frame data
commit
|
commitdiff
|
tree
2018-01-24
Vlad Brezae
[inter
p
]
A
bide by the abort
t
h
reshold
c
o
n
s
traint
commit
|
commitdiff
|
tree
2018-01-24
Vlad
B
rezae
[int
e
rp] Interp frames are
a
lso
m
anaged
commit
|
commitdiff
|
tree
2018-01-24
Vlad Breza
e
[
inter
p
] Initialize sp for first i
n
terp frame
commit
|
commitdiff
|
tree
2018-01-24
Vlad Brezae
[
inter
p
] Remov
e
chec
k
s not
needed for t
r
y bloc
k
s
commit
|
commitdiff
|
tree
2018-01-23
Vlad Brezae
[interp] Disa
b
le mixe
d
mod
e
test
s
commit
|
commitdiff
|
tree
2018-01-22
Vl
a
d Brezae
[in
t
erp] Decrease stack usage (#6
5
8
0
)
commit
|
commitdiff
|
tree
2018-01-22
Vlad
B
rezae
[interp] Disable t
e
sts on
arm d
u
e to known iss
u
e
commit
|
commitdiff
|
tree
2018-01-18
Vla
d
Br
e
z
a
e
[interp] Add check
for c
l
ass failure
commit
|
commitdiff
|
tree
2018-01-18
Vlad Brezae
[tests] Change test to use
less
stack
commit
|
commitdiff
|
tree
2018-01-17
Vlad Brez
a
e
[runtime] Fix ji
t
info leak when
having aot images
.
.
.
commit
|
commitdiff
|
tree
2018-01-17
Vlad Brezae
[mini] Fix seq point
i
nfo leak (#65
2
2)
commit
|
commitdiff
|
tree
2018-01-17
Vlad Brezae
[s
g
en] Fix ove
r
flow
o
n
large ar
r
ays (#6542)
commit
|
commitdiff
|
tree
2018-01-11
Vl
a
d
Brezae
[
t
e
st] Ren
a
me test
commit
|
commitdiff
|
tree
2018-01-11
Vlad Brezae
[interp] Add
s
u
pport for ldflda with remoting
commit
|
commitdiff
|
tree
2018-01-11
Vlad B
r
ezae
[interp] Allow interp stack t
o
be greater than il stack
commit
|
commitdiff
|
tree
2018-01-08
V
l
ad Brezae
[i
n
terp]
A
dd missing param sup
p
ort for floa
t
ing ty
p
es
.
.
.
commit
|
commitdiff
|
tree
2018-01-05
Vlad Brezae
[int
e
rp] Interp fixes (#6334)
commit
|
commitdiff
|
tree
2017-12-23
V
lad Brezae
[
i
nterp]
Rena
m
e functions to be clearer
commit
|
commitdiff
|
tree
2017-12-23
V
lad
B
rezae
[in
t
erp] Enable most pinvok
e
test
s
commit
|
commitdiff
|
tree
2017-12-23
V
lad Brezae
[arm
6
4] Rework native en
t
r
y tr
a
mp from interp
commit
|
commitdiff
|
tree
2017-12-23
Vlad Bre
z
ae
[arm]
I
nterp support for pinvok
e
commit
|
commitdiff
|
tree
2017-12-21
Vlad
Bre
z
ae
[
interp] Don'
t
a
bort dur
i
ng
f
i
n
a
l
l
y
blocks
commit
|
commitdiff
|
tree
2017-12-21
Vlad Br
e
zae
[in
t
erp] Re
m
ove duplicated code
commit
|
commitdiff
|
tree
2017-12-21
Vlad Brezae
[
i
n
t
erp] Check for interruption after
c
lass initiali
z
ation
commit
|
commitdiff
|
tree
2017-12-21
Vlad Brezae
[i
n
terp] Replac
e
old
and dead EH code
commit
|
commitdiff
|
tree
2017-12-21
V
lad Brezae
[interp] Check
f
o
r class fa
i
lu
r
e when
emitting constructo
r
commit
|
commitdiff
|
tree
2017-12-18
Vlad Brezae
[sgen] Fix behavior of forced collections
commit
|
commitdiff
|
tree
2017-12-18
V
l
a
d
Brezae
[prof
i
ler] Tri
g
ger heapsh
o
ts only on
m
ajor
s
erial collecti
o
n
s
commit
|
commitdiff
|
tree
2017-12-18
Vlad Brezae
[profiler] R
e
port r
o
ots fr
o
m
e
phemerons
commit
|
commitdiff
|
tree
2017-12-16
Vlad Breza
e
[amd64] Rework native entry tramp from interp
commit
|
commitdiff
|
tree
2017-12-15
V
lad Br
e
zae
[interp] Restore value
t
y
pe copying
for pinvoke case
.
commit
|
commitdiff
|
tree
2017-12-15
V
l
ad Br
e
zae
[in
t
erp] Add some missin
g
ica
l
l si
g
natures
commit
|
commitdiff
|
tree
2017-12-15
Vlad Brezae
[interp] Replac
e
defin
e
commit
|
commitdiff
|
tree
2017-12-15
Vla
d
Brezae
[int
e
r
p
] Fix delegate invocat
i
on of na
t
ive
f
unctio
n
s
commit
|
commitdiff
|
tree
2017-12-15
Vlad
Breza
e
[ma
r
sh
a
l
]
A
voi
d
u
s
ing CEE_UNB
O
X for str
u
ct marsh
a
ling
commit
|
commitdiff
|
tree
2017-12-15
Vla
d
Brezae
[me
t
adata]
Remove un
u
sed ldloc
commit
|
commitdiff
|
tree
2017-12-15
Vlad Bre
z
ae
[i
n
te
r
p] Remove assert
commit
|
commitdiff
|
tree
2017-12-01
Vlad Brezae
[mini]
Add missin
g
try
ho
l
es
commit
|
commitdiff
|
tree
2017-11-24
Vlad Brezae
[
m
ini] Align stack when resumin
g
t
o catch handler
commit
|
commitdiff
|
tree
2017-11-24
Vlad Brez
a
e
[mini] Add counter for t
r
y
holes m
e
mory
u
sage
commit
|
commitdiff
|
tree
2017-11-24
V
l
ad Brezae
[min
i
] A
d
d
m
issing try hol
e
s
commit
|
commitdiff
|
tree
2017-11-24
Vlad Breza
e
[mini] Fix clause
t
ry hole checking
commit
|
commitdiff
|
tree
2017-11-04
Vla
d
B
r
e
z
ae
[
i
nt
e
rp] Throw exce
p
tio
n
in case of
fie
l
d access failure
commit
|
commitdiff
|
tree
2017-11-04
Vla
d
B
rez
a
e
[
interp] Enable
s
o
m
e tests
commit
|
commitdiff
|
tree
2017-11-04
Vl
a
d
B
rezae
[interp] Don't sigsegv
on
f
ie
l
d lo
o
k
up
f
ailure
commit
|
commitdiff
|
tree
2017-11-04
Vlad B
r
e
zae
[inte
r
p]
D
o
n't assert on ldtoken failure
commit
|
commitdiff
|
tree
2017-11-04
Vl
a
d Brezae
[inter
p
]
F
ix error p
r
opa
g
ation fr
o
m interp inv
o
ke
commit
|
commitdiff
|
tree
2017-11-03
Vl
a
d B
r
ezae
[i
n
terp
]
U
s
e
x
doma
i
n wrappers as
w
ith norm
a
l
j
i
t
commit
|
commitdiff
|
tree
2017-11-03
Vlad
B
rezae
[
i
nte
r
p]
D
o
n
'
t ret
h
row cur
r
ent frame exce
p
tion aft
e
r
.
.
.
commit
|
commitdiff
|
tree
2017-11-03
V
l
ad Brez
a
e
[
i
n
terp] S
e
t correct stack type f
o
r ic
a
ll return
commit
|
commitdiff
|
tree
2017-11-03
Vlad Brezae
[interp] Fix constructor call on transpare
n
t proxies
.
.
.
commit
|
commitdiff
|
tree
2017-10-31
V
l
a
d
Brezae
[sgen]
Collect m
a
jor after user requeste
d
minor collect
i
ons
commit
|
commitdiff
|
tree
2017-10-20
Vlad B
r
ezae
Me
r
ge pull reque
s
t #582
5
from B
r
z
V
lad/fi
x
-interp-a
p
pd
o
main
commit
|
commitdiff
|
tree
2017-10-20
V
lad
B
rezae
[
i
nterp] Enable appdomain tes
t
s
commit
|
commitdiff
|
tree
2017-10-20
V
lad
B
rezae
[
interp] Reth
r
ow abort exceptio
n
s at end of c
a
tch
commit
|
commitdiff
|
tree
2017-10-20
V
l
ad Br
e
zae
[interp] Interrupt
i
on
checkpoint during branc
h
es
commit
|
commitdiff
|
tree
2017-10-20
Vl
a
d Br
e
zae
[int
e
rp] Han
d
le
r
e
moting
cal
l
s
in
delegates
commit
|
commitdiff
|
tree
2017-10-20
Vlad Brez
a
e
[
i
nterp] Add
lmf
when do
i
ng ica
l
ls
commit
|
commitdiff
|
tree
2017-10-20
Vlad Brezae
[int
e
rp] Don'
t
generat
e
re
m
oting wrapper for nor
m
al
.
.
.
commit
|
commitdiff
|
tree
2017-10-20
V
lad Br
e
za
e
[inter
p
] F
i
x tls ji
t
point
e
r fetch
commit
|
commitdiff
|
tree
next